Mal
Though I have a Khumbu version of the vest that can, the Magnum version cannot hold the 600, so I was carrying the 600 with the strap on my shoulder. Bodies, smaller lenses and other accessories were put in the vest pockets. Note that the problem wasn&#039;t the weight of the bag but the concern that it wouldn&#039;t fit the overhead compartments.
I wasn&#039;t overly concerned for my lens as it is anyway protected with a lenscoat and during travel another thicker lenscoat pouch and lenscoat cap.
I suppose that you could do the same with the 2-4 which is anyway smaller than the 600.]]></description>
